Animals, plants, fungi and bacteria use carbohydrates in varying ways. For plants, carbohydrates form a large part of their structure in the form of cellulose. Animals use carbohydrates primarily for energy, such as starch, glucose and other sugars. Bacteria use carbohydrates for both structure and energy.

Definition. noun, plural: (genetics, ecology) A group of organisms of one species that interbreed and live in the same place at the same time (e.g. deer population) (taxonomy) A low-level taxonomic rank. (statistics) A set of individuals, objects, or data from where a statistical sample can be drawn.
